INDUSTRIAL CONDUCTIVITY CELLS


Conductivity cells are used for electric conductivity measurements in liquids, with use of conductivity meters. Sometimes they are called a conductivity electrodes, but it is the incorrect name, as the electrodes are a part of the conductivity cell and they are placed inside the measuring cell.
Most often the conductivity cells are equipped with platinum electrodes, platinum electrodes covered with platinum black or metal electrodes (in most cases steel).
